The transparency-fixer now directly detects the baked-in checkerboard
pattern using per-pixel chroma analysis instead of BiRefNet AI matting.
Achromatic pixels in the gray range are classified as background
(transparent), chromatic pixels as foreground (opaque), with smooth
transitions at anti-aliased edges.

The luminance anomaly detection + LaMa inpainting approach failed because
watermark signal on the matted foreground was too weak (10-15 units vs
threshold of 25). Median filter with kernel=5 effectively removes
semi-transparent watermark text while preserving the stamp structure.
Pipeline is now: median filter (if toggle on) -> BiRefNet matting -> defringe.
No longer requires object-eraser-colorize bundle for watermark removal.

AVIF (and other Sharp-native formats) were written as raw bytes to a
.png temp file, causing PIL to fail with "cannot identify image file".
Every other AI module wrapper already converts via sharp().png().toBuffer()
before writing; face-landmarks was the only one that skipped this step.
HDR and EXR files decoded by ImageMagick can produce 16-bit PNG buffers.
Sharp's CLAHE operation (hist_local) requires VIPS_FORMAT_UCHAR (8-bit).
Check the buffer depth and convert to 8-bit sRGB before processing.
The wrapper used inline-block for tools without overlay children (e.g.
border). CSS maxHeight: 100% on the img inside an inline-block parent
without explicit height does not resolve, so tall images rendered at
natural height and got clipped by overflow: hidden. Unify both code
paths to always use inline-flex + column, where the flex item properly
shrinks within the container's maxHeight constraint.
Sharp's TIFF encoder silently strips the alpha channel, flattening
transparency against black. This caused border (corner radius, shadow),
beautify, and replace-color tools to produce wrong output for TIFF
inputs when the operation needs transparency. Remove TIFF from
ALPHA_FORMATS so these tools fall back to PNG output.
